Thai character strings or mixed Thai-English strings starting with Thai
character are displayed in Calc cell as right-aligned by default. Thai text in
the cell should be left-aligned by default like English or other Western
language.
To work around this bug, one need to format all the cells as left-aligned to
display the content as it should be, which is quite a burden. This problem does
not exist in OpenOffie 3.3.
To investigate this bug, copy and paste either of the following two character
strings, paste into a cell, hit Enter key, and see the alignment of the cell
content.
สวัสดี
ก English texts starting with a single Thai character.
